Title :  COLICIN E9 IMMUNITY PROTEIN IM9, NMR, MINIMIZED AVERAGE STRUCTURE
 
Authors :  M. J. Osborne, A. L. Breeze, L. Y. Lian, A. Reilly, R. James, C. Kleanthous, G. R. Moore
Date :  30 May 96  (Deposition) - 07 Jul 97  (Release) - 24 Feb 09  (Revision)
Method :  SOLUTION NMR
Resolution :  NOT APPLICABLE
Chains :  NMR Structure  :  A
Keywords :  Immunity Protein, Bacteriocin, Plasmid, Colicin (Keyword Search: [Gene Ontology, PubMed, Web (Google))
 
Reference :  M. J. Osborne, A. L. Breeze, L. Y. Lian, A. Reilly, R. James, C. Kleanthous, G. R. Moore
Three-Dimensional Solution Structure And 13C Nuclear Magnetic Resonance Assignments Of The Colicin E9 Immunity Protein Im9.
Biochemistry V. 35 9505 1996
PubMed-ID: 8755730  |  Reference-DOI: 10.1021/BI960401K

Chain A   (IMM9_ECOLX | P13479)
molecular function
    GO:0015643    toxic substance binding    Interacting selectively and non-covalently with a toxic substance, a poisonous substance that causes damage to biological systems.
biological process
    GO:0030153    bacteriocin immunity    A process that mediates resistance to a bacteriocin: any of a heterogeneous group of polypeptide antibiotics that are secreted by certain bacterial strains and are able to kill cells of other susceptible (frequently related) strains after adsorption at specific receptors on the cell surface. They include the colicins, and their mechanisms of action vary.
